导读:MySQL是一种流行的关系型数据库管理系统,支持多种不同的数据模式 。本文将介绍MySQL中常用的几种数据模式,并讨论它们的优缺点 。
1. 垂直分区模式(Vertical Partitioning)
垂直分区模式将表按列拆分成多个子表,每个子表包含主表的一部分列 。这种模式可以提高查询性能和降低存储开销,但会增加复杂性和维护难度 。
2. 水平分区模式(Horizontal Partitioning)
水平分区模式将表按行拆分成多个子表 , 每个子表包含主表的一部分行 。这种模式可以提高查询性能和并发性能,但会增加复杂性和维护难度 。
3. 分片模式(Sharding)
分片模式将数据按照某种规则拆分成多个片段,每个片段存储在不同的服务器上 。这种模式可以提高扩展性和容错性,但会增加复杂性和维护难度 。
4. 复制模式(Replication)
复制模式将数据复制到多个服务器上 , 每个服务器都有完整的数据副本 。这种模式可以提高可用性和容错性,但会增加复杂性和维护难度 。
【mysql的模型 mysql几种模式】总结:MySQL中有多种不同的数据模式可供选择,每种模式都有其优缺点 。在选择模式时需要考虑到应用场景和需求,并根据实际情况进行权衡和选择 。
推荐阅读
- mysql缓存大小设置 mysql应用缓存
- mysql怎么取消密码 mysql解除访问权限
- mysql 查看实例 mysql中如何查看事件
- mysql自动计算字段 Mysql自动算环比
- MySQL数据模型中,经常将被研究的对象称作 mysql数据模型
- 如何在云服务器上访问国外网站? 云服务器怎么连接国外网站
- redis监测 探测redis版本
- redis持久化数据和缓存怎么做扩容 redis固化磁盘命令
- redis单节点 redis单例设计模式